WebFeb 20, 2024 · Given an array of integers, find sum of array elements using recursion. Examples: Input : A [] = {1, 2, 3} Output : 6 1 + 2 + 3 = 6 Input : A [] = {15, 12, 13, 10} Output : 50 Recommended Practice Sum … WebApr 13,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with …
Did you know?
WebApr 10, 2024 · Write a recursive function that returns the subsets of the array that sum to the target. The return type of the function should be ArrayList. Print the value returned. Input: 5 1 3 5 7 0 6 Output: [1 5, 1 5 0 ] java. recursion. arraylist. WebNov 29, 2024 · c-program-arrays-patterns-and-string / CUMULATIVE SUM.c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. rohanmahaveer Add files via upload. Latest commit caa5a52 Nov 29, 2024 History.
WebDec 29, 2010 · int sum = Arrays.stream (new int [] {1,2,3,4}, 0, 2).sum (); //prints 3 Finally, it can take an array of type T. So you can per example have a String which contains numbers as an input and if you want to sum them just do : int sum = Arrays.stream ("1 2 3 4".split ("\\s+")).mapToInt (Integer::parseInt).sum (); Share Improve this answer Follow WebNov 3, 2024 · We define a running sum of an array as runningSum [i] > = sum (nums [0]…nums [i]). Return the running sum of nums. Example 1: Input: nums = [1,2,3,4] Output: [1,3,6,10] Explanation: Running sum is obtained as follows: [1, 1+2, 1+2+3, 1+2+3+4]. Example 2: Input: nums = [1,1,1,1,1] Output: [1,2,3,4,5]
WebIf you're doing much numerical work with arrays like this, I'd suggest numpy, which comes with a cumulative sum function cumsum: import numpy as np a = [4,6,12] np.cumsum (a) #array ( [4, 10, 22]) Numpy is often faster than pure python for this kind of thing, see in comparison to @Ashwini's accumu: WebWe define a running sum of an array as runningSum [i] = sum (nums [0]…nums [i]). Return the running sum of nums. Example 1: Input: nums = [1,2,3,4] Output: [1,3,6,10] …
WebMay 3, 2024 · In a prefix sum array, we will create a duplicate array which contains the running sum of the elements 0 to i of our original array (nums) for each index i of our prefix sum array (ans). (Note: We can lower the …
WebSep 6, 2024 · Approach: Create scanner class object. Ask use length of the array. Initialize the array with given size. Ask the user for array … is baku in the middle eastWebWe can optimize this algorithm using the cumulative sum technique. A cumulative sum array is one whose value at each index is the sum of all previous indexes plus itself … is balagtas a cityWebWe define a running sum of an array as runningSum [i] = sum (nums [0]…nums [i]). Return the running sum of nums. Example 1: Input: nums = [1,2,3,4] Output: [1,3,6,10] Explanation: Running sum is obtained as follows: [1, 1+2, 1+2+3, 1+2+3+4]. Example 2: is bakugou dead in the mangaWebApr 7, 2024 · To calculate the sum of values of a Map data structure, first we create a stream from the values of that Map. Next we apply one of the methods we … is bakugou ticklishWebMar 14, 2024 · It is guaranteed that the sum of n for all test cases does not exceed 2⋅105 . Output For each test case print one integer — the number of distinct strings that can be obtained by removing two consecutive letters. 查看. 我可以回答这个问题。. 这道题目可以通过遍历字符串,找到相邻的两个字符,然后删除 ... is balance billing legal in oregonWebOct 7, 2024 · Given an unsorted array. The task is to calculate the cumulative frequency of each element of the array using a count array. Examples: Input : arr [] = [1, 2, 2, 1, 3, 4] Output :1->2 2->4 3->5 4->6 Input : arr [] = [1, 1, 1, 2, 2, 2] Output :1->3 2->6 Recommended: Please solve it on “ PRACTICE ” first, before moving on to the solution. is balance a group 2 herbicideWebApr 14, 2024 · const valuesSum = function (arr) { let sum = 0; for (let i = 0; i < arr.length; i++) { // sum = sum + arr [i]; // or either you can use: sum += arr [i]; } return sum; } console.log (valuesSum (invoiceValues)); console.log (valuesSum (onlyVatValues)); console.log (valuesSum (onlyTaxableValues)); Enjoy! Share Improve this answer Follow is bala cynwyd in montgomery county